50 Quotes of John F.Kennedy 

1. Leadership and learning are indispensable to each other.
2. As we express our gratitude, we must never forget that the highest appreciation is not to utter words, but to live by them.
3. Things do not happen. Things are made to happen.
4. My fellow Americans, ask not what your country can do for you, ask what you can do for your country.

5. We are not here to curse the darkness, but to light the candle that can guide us thru that darkness to a safe and sane future.
